Augment Code vs Cursor: A Detailed Comparison of Two AI-Powered Coding Assistants

Augment Code vs Cursor: A Detailed Comparison of Two AI-Powered Coding Assistants

In the rapidly evolving world of AI-driven software development, tools like Augment Code and Cursor are reshaping how developers write, review, and understand code. Both offer compelling features, tight IDE integrations, and GPT-backed intelligence. But after extensive testing and real-world usage, Augment Code stands out as the more capable, developer-friendly tool.

Here's a deep dive into both platforms and why Augment Code ultimately wins.


🧠 1. AI Capability and Code Understanding

Augment Code:

Augment Code impresses with its deep contextual understanding of entire codebases. Whether you're navigating legacy monoliths or modular microservices, Augment Code doesn’t just answer your prompts — it learns from your code, building a contextual map across files, functions, and classes. The tool feels less like a chatbot and more like an AI pair programmer that actually understands what you're building.

  • Context awareness spans across multiple files.
  • Robust handling of edge cases and architectural questions.
  • Inline comment analysis and traceable code history.

Cursor:

Cursor uses OpenAI models effectively but feels more like a smarter Copilot than a true AI collaborator. It excels in writing and editing isolated functions or components, but often lacks deeper project-wide awareness.

  • Great for autocomplete and minor edits.
  • Struggles when reasoning across deeply coupled code.
  • Prompts often require more manual framing and explanation.

🔎 Verdict: Augment Code's context retention and comprehension give it a significant edge, especially in enterprise-scale projects.


🛠️ 2. Developer Experience and Workflow Integration

Augment Code:

Augment Code isn’t just an AI tool — it’s a full developer assistant platform. Its VSCode integration is seamless, and the command palette UX is intuitive and fast. Its "Ask why this changed", "Explain this pull request", or "Trace this bug" features are particularly invaluable for teams.

  • Native support for PR reviews, inline annotations, and changelog generation.
  • Fast, responsive UI with thoughtful prompts built into developer workflows.
  • Supports contextual chat tied to specific lines or diffs.

Cursor:

Cursor’s interface is polished and responsive, but much of the UX feels borrowed from ChatGPT and GitHub Copilot. While it has a strong code editing experience, it lacks Augment Code’s workflow-centric features, especially for teams working in large repositories.

  • Excellent autocomplete and suggestion engine.
  • Chat interface is decoupled from deeper Git workflows.
  • Still early in collaborative features.

🧭 Verdict: Augment Code offers a richer, more integrated experience tailored to real-world development tasks.


🧪 3. Codebase Navigation and Understanding

Augment Code:

Augment provides semantic code navigation and lets you ask questions like:

  • “Where is this bug introduced?”
  • “What does this refactor achieve?”
  • “How is this component used in production?”

It generates answers backed by code references, graphs, and documentation context. It’s not just helpful — it’s transformative for onboarding and debugging.

Cursor:

Cursor allows for fast file access and single-function explanations, but lacks the deep search and cross-repo intelligence found in Augment Code. It’s good for local tasks, not for architectural exploration.

🧠 Verdict: For deep dives into large codebases, Augment is simply in a different league.


🤖 4. AI Model Power and Customization

Augment Code:

Supports custom fine-tuned models based on your codebase. You can even configure it to prioritize your internal conventions and documentation. Over time, it gets better at mirroring your org’s engineering culture.

Cursor:

Cursor is fast and light, but generally limited to generic GPT-4 outputs, with less control or tuning for your unique environment.

⚙️ Verdict: Augment offers smarter, more customizable AI, making it suitable for engineering teams with specific needs.


📈 5. Team Collaboration and Scaling

Augment Code:

Designed for teams, not just solo developers. From reviewing pull requests with natural-language summaries to tracking TODOs across a team, Augment Code shines in collaborative environments. It integrates tightly with GitHub, GitLab, and Bitbucket.

Cursor:

Cursor is primarily a solo-developer tool, and while excellent in its domain, it’s currently not optimized for team-level tasks like changelog generation or PR feedback loops.

👥 Verdict: For teams and scale, Augment is the clear winner.


🧩 6. Pricing and Ecosystem

While pricing changes over time, both platforms offer generous free tiers. However, Augment Code’s team plans include enterprise-grade features (SSO, audit logs, self-hosting options) that make it a better long-term investment for growing engineering orgs.


🏆 Final Verdict: Why Augment Code Wins

Category Winner
AI Code Understanding Augment Code
IDE Integration Augment Code
Project-wide Reasoning Augment Code
Team Collaboration Augment Code
Code Navigation & Debugging Augment Code
Solo Development Speed Cursor
Autocomplete Performance Cursor

While Cursor is fast and lightweight — a perfect tool for individual developers who need smart autocomplete — Augment Code offers a broader, deeper, and more intelligent platform for professional software teams.

If you’re working on complex systems, contributing to shared codebases, or onboarding new engineers, Augment Code isn’t just helpful — it’s essential.


Bottom Line:

Cursor helps you write code. Augment Code helps you understand it.
In the era of AI-native software engineering, understanding wins.